TOP API INTEGRATION FOR MICROSERVICES SECRETS

Top API integration for microservices Secrets

Top API integration for microservices Secrets

Blog Article

The cons of microservices can consist of: Development sprawl – Microservices add far more complexity when compared to a monolith architecture, given that you can find extra services in more sites created by many groups.

By the nineties, the stage had been established for dispersed techniques Which may take full advantage of recent developments in network computing.

“I spent additional time ensuring that our SRE team was effective On this task than Pretty much almost every other operate which i did in the course of the challenge because the cultural shift was the most important very long-expression big difference for Atlassian as a result of Vertigo,” Tria said.

Happier teams – The Atlassian groups who function with microservices absolutely are a whole lot happier, since These are far more autonomous and can Develop and deploy by themselves with out waiting around months to get a pull ask for to generally be accepted.

They can also deploy certain services independently. These kinds of an method is useful in the continual deployment workflow where developers make frequent small adjustments with no impacting the process's steadiness. 

The choice of software architecture shouldn’t be designed within a vacuum or with out a clear comprehension of your Business’s Original and eventual info processing requires simply because whichever architectural solution is decided on should have profound results to the organization’s capability to meaningfully execute on its enterprise aims.

Technological know-how overall flexibility – Microservice architectures permit groups the liberty to select the equipment they desire. Significant reliability – You may deploy modifications for a selected services, devoid of the threat of bringing down your entire application.

Screening a monolithic software is normally less complicated due to absence of inter-provider conversation and using one runtime surroundings.

Builders can not rebuild specific areas of the code base with new click here technological frameworks, which delays your Firm in adopting present day technological tendencies.

Scaling certain aspects of the application independently is difficult since the system is deployed as a whole. Methods are frequently about-provisioned to fulfill the demands of large-load parts.

In the meantime, the microservices architecture supports dispersed methods. Just about every software component receives its possess computing sources in the dispersed procedure.

Embrace a culture change "Tradition matters a whole lot in These types of enormous projects," explained Viswanath. "You would like to be certain when there is a difficulty that It really is percolated up each time." Whenever you do a migration, It truly is not just a specialized migration, but a people today and organizational alter.

However, they can become sophisticated and hard to sustain as the size and complexity of the application expand.

Tooling The appropriate instruments are crucial when undergoing a microserivces migration. We didn’t migrate customers straight away, but somewhat very first invested and created instruments for the migration, figuring out it was a marathon in place of a sprint. A very powerful tool we created was Microscope, our own interior provider catalog to trace all of the microservices. Just about every developer at Atlassian can use Microscope to discover all the information of any microservice while in the company. We also crafted tooling in Microscope named ServiceQuest that automtically detects checks on code just before generation, which incorporates checks for top quality, assistance design, privacy, safety, and dependability.

Report this page